Skip to content

Commit f6a440d

Browse files
sukru-can1claude
andcommitted
fix: set correct base path for GitHub Pages deployment
Assets (CSS, favicon) were loading from root / instead of /flyweb.io/ since this is a project repo, not a user.github.io repo.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
1 parent 83c6ba8 commit f6a440d

2 files changed

Lines changed: 3 additions & 2 deletions

File tree

astro.config.mjs

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,8 @@ import { defineConfig } from 'astro/config';
22
import tailwind from '@astrojs/tailwind';
33

44
export default defineConfig({
5-
site: 'https://flyweb.io',
5+
site: 'https://flywebprotocol.github.io',
6+
base: '/flyweb.io',
67
integrations: [tailwind()],
78
output: 'static',
89
});

src/layouts/Layout.astro

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@ const { title, description } = Astro.props;
2222
<meta name="twitter:card" content="summary_large_image" />
2323
<meta name="twitter:title" content={title} />
2424
<meta name="twitter:description" content={description} />
25-
<link rel="icon" type="image/svg+xml" href="/favicon.svg" />
25+
<link rel="icon" type="image/svg+xml" href={`${import.meta.env.BASE_URL}/favicon.svg`} />
2626
<link rel="preconnect" href="https://fonts.googleapis.com" />
2727
<link rel="preconnect" href="https://fonts.gstatic.com" crossorigin />
2828
<link href="https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700;800;900&family=Space+Grotesk:wght@500;600;700&display=swap" rel="stylesheet" />

0 commit comments

Comments
 (0)